The … proctor theater scheduleWebAug 24, 2006 · The Stewart J. Cort was the very first 1000-foot-long ship built for the Great Lakes. The bow and stern sections were built in Pascagoula, Mississippi, while the 815-foot mid-section was built at Erie, Pennsylvania. The whole ship began service for Bethlehem Steel Co. in 1972.
